Email from Hubert Jan 2, 2020:

The new Hubert GO Web is coming soon.
Our new online banking site, Hubert GO Web, will be available starting January 8. Along with an updated look, the new site will include the following features:
•Self-serve password reset
•Nickname accounts
•Postdate transfers
•Ability to create / modify reoccurring transactions
•Start chat while in internet banking

Just checked it out. Seems like a step backwards. Looks pretty, but preferred the old site where I could see all the info summarized on one page. Have to search each account now for interest dates, rates, maturity. Now just shows the balance. I'lll stick with the old one until it's not an option.
